Eat Healthy Meals With The ‘Never Two In A Row’ Plan

We all tend to indulge our food cravings once in a while, which means added pounds and broken diets — especially on holidays. Try alternating healthy and unhealthy meals to avoid going on a binge.

The idea is similar to a tip we’ve shared before to keep your healthy habits going through holidays. You can give yourself the freedom to try whatever you like without worrying about your diet, just balance your choices with healthier options in the next meal, says Nerd Fitness:

If you eat a bad meal, make the next one a healthy one…no exceptions! Opt for the side salad instead of extra french fries. Get grilled chicken instead of breaded chicken. Eat a healthy snack instead of more cookies and crackers. The goal here isn’t to stay 100% on track, but rather to keep your momentum so it’s easier to get back on track at the end.

Remember, you can still get delicious food while eating healthy. It’s a simple matter of choices. For example, vacations are a great time to explore local cuisine, and most cuisines have healthy dishes too, especially when it comes to what the natives eat, so ask for that.

The full post has some other good ideas to stay healthy on vacations, such as a workout game and restricting carbs to your drinks as much as possible.
